华南理工大学学报(自然科学版) ›› 2013, Vol. 41 ›› Issue (1): 38-46.doi: 10.3969/j.issn.1000-565X.2013.01.006

• 电子、通信与自动控制 • 上一篇    下一篇

基于虚拟嵌入块和量化器原点抖动的YASS 改进算法

马丽红 李晓 吕先明   

  1. 华南理工大学 电子与信息学院//近距离无线通信与网络教育部工程研究中心, 广东 广州 510640
  • 收稿日期:2012-04-19 修回日期:2012-08-16 出版日期:2013-01-25 发布日期:2012-12-03
  • 通信作者: 马丽红(1965-),女,博士,教授,主要从事图像视频信号分析、容错编码和数据隐藏、模式识别研究. E-mail:eelhma@scut.edu.cn
  • 作者简介:马丽红(1965-),女,博士,教授,主要从事图像视频信号分析、容错编码和数据隐藏、模式识别研究.
  • 基金资助:

    国家自然科学基金资助项目(60972133);广东省自然科学基金团队项目(9351064101000003)

Improved YASS Algorithm Based on Virtual Embedding Blocks andOrigin Dithering of Quantizers

Ma Li-hong Li Xiao Lü Xian-ming   

  1. School of Electronic and Information Engineering//Engineering Research Center of the Ministry of Education for NearWireless Communication and Network, South China University of Technology, Guangzhou 510640, Guangdong, China
  • Received:2012-04-19 Revised:2012-08-16 Online:2013-01-25 Published:2012-12-03
  • Contact: 马丽红(1965-),女,博士,教授,主要从事图像视频信号分析、容错编码和数据隐藏、模式识别研究. E-mail:eelhma@scut.edu.cn
  • About author:马丽红(1965-),女,博士,教授,主要从事图像视频信号分析、容错编码和数据隐藏、模式识别研究.
  • Supported by:

    国家自然科学基金资助项目(60972133);广东省自然科学基金团队项目(9351064101000003)

摘要: 为了提高YASS 算法的隐写安全性,提出一种基于灵活次序的虚拟嵌入块和量化器原点随机抖动的YASS 改进算法——VHD-YASS 算法. 为了增加嵌入位置的随机性,该改进算法在每个载体块内随机选取一个不规则区域,重新生成一个虚拟的8×8 小块来取代传统YASS 算法中规则的8×8 嵌入块,用于消息的嵌入;然后,通过密钥控制量化索引调制( QIM) 中奇/ 偶量化器的原点偏移,消除QIM 量化步长较大时消息嵌入造成的DCT 系数聚集效应. 将文中改进算法与传统YASS 算法和两种不同的改进YASS 算法进行了对比实验,结果表明:在同一嵌入容量下,文中改进算法的检测概率最高为0. 614,而传统YASS 算法的检测概率最高为0. 983. 从抗隐写分析能力、可视性及算法复杂度方面综合分析可知,文中算法是一种有效的隐写算法.

关键词: YASS 算法, 虚拟嵌入块, 量化器, 原点抖动, 观测域, 隐写分析

Abstract:

In order to improve the security of YASS algorithm, a modified high-randomness YASS algorithm namedVHD-YASS is proposed based on the virtual embedding blocks and the origin dithering of quantizers. In this algo-rithm, in order to improve the randomness of the embedding position, a virtual 8×8 H-block, which is used asa substitution of regular 8×8 H-block in the conventional YASS algorithm for message embedding, is created byrandomly selecting an irregular region in each B-block. Then, the shifts of origins of odd/ even QIM (Quantiza-tion Index Modulation) quantizers are controlled by a secrete key to avoid the DCT coefficient clusters due to themessage embedding under the condition of long QIM step. Finally, the proposed algorithm is compared with theconventional YASS algorithm and with two other improved YASS algorithms by experiments. The results show that,at the same embedding rate, the proposed algorithm attains a maximum detectability of 0.614, which is dramaticallyless than the conventional one of 0. 983, and that VHD-YASS is an effective steganography scheme because it is oflarge anti-steganalysis capability, excellent visibility and low complexity.

Key words: YASS algorithm, virtual embedding block, quantizer, origin dithering, observation domain, stegano-graphy analysis

中图分类号: